7th November, 2008 a phone rings at one of Denmark's largest shipping companies, Clipper. Somali pirates have hijacked the cargo vessel CEC Future and 13 crew members. The pirates demand 7 mio dollar. A nightmare has just begun.
For the first time ever a TV-documentary reveals the dramatic negotiations between a Western shipping company and Somali pirates. Experts are flown from London to Copenhagen to assist Clipper's CEO, Per Gullestrup, who faces a nervewrecking and very unusual task: He will have to try to strike a deal with pirates thousands of kilometers away and is under enormous pressure to free his crew members as quickly as possible. Per Gullestrup has to withstand threats and call bluffs as the crew slowly breaks down.
We followed the dramatic events in a hijacking that lasted more than two months. Authentic footage discloses negotiations, as they took place. And in an exclusive interview the pirate's negotiator reveals the tactics of the pirates on board.
Finally, 68 days later, in January 2009, the deal was finally settled and the money drop was made.
